Ahmed Samir (Arabic: أحمد سمير, born 25 August 1994); is an Egyptian footballer who plays for Al Ittihad Alexandria Club.
Club career
Dakhleya
Samir played for El Dakhleya in the Egyptian Premier League and made his debut in 2011 versus Al-Mokawloon Al-Arab.
Zamalek
Samir signed for Zamalek in 2014 summer transfers. He won the Premier league.
International career
He won the African Youth Championship with Egypt in March 2013, scoring in the final's penalty shoot-out. .[1]
